Independent Polish studio Moonlit and publishing Green Man Gaming Publishing recently released a free public version of their future simulator Model Builder… And within gamescom 2023 showed its passage with comments from the developers.

Model Builder will have two modes. In the traditional storyline, we will inherit a small workshop, and we can study it, practice creating and painting miniatures and models, and over time improve and expand our territory and range of possibilities.

In sandbox mode, all tools and templates will be available from the very beginning, and we will only be limited by our own imagination. The game will contain both real models and assets from various games.

In particular, in the demo we will be able to color the work gnome Titan forge and build the British Supermarine Spitfire. And not so long ago, we recall, the creators of the game announced cooperation with the authors Frostpunk: Mechanisms from the cold world will appear in the game.
Model Builder comes out in October on PC.
